In which of the following is the surface of the cornea curved more steeply on one side than on the other?
 
  A) hyperopia
  B) myopia
  C) astigmatism
  D) amblyopia

Answer to Question 1

C
Explanation: A) This does not describe hyperopia (farsightedness).
B) This does not describe myopia (nearsightedness).
C) Correct
D) This does not describe amblyopia (lazy eye).

Answer to Question 2

D
Explanation: A) A lesion does not always involve inflammation.
B) Edema is swelling in the tissues, not inflammation.
C) Inflammation does not always include an infection.
D) Correct Dermat/o- means skin and -itis means inflammation of.

Glaucoma is a leading cause of blindness. As of yet, there is no cure. Everyone is at risk, and there may be no warning signs. It is six to eight times more common in African Americans than in whites. The best and most effective way to detect glaucoma is to receive a dilated eye examination.
